The video tutorial explains how to solve exponential equations by converting them into logarithmic form. It discusses the importance of base conversion and the use of logarithms to isolate variables. The instructor demonstrates solving for the variable T by dividing and using the change of base formula. The tutorial concludes with clarifications on the calculation process and encourages students to use calculators for final evaluations.
